RELATING TO SCHOOLS.

Establishes a workforce readiness program within the department of education to allow students to graduate from an extended high school enrollment with a high school diploma and an industry-recognized associate's degree.  Appropriates moneys to develop and implement the program.  Takes effect on July 1, 2050.  (SD1)
